Blockchain and decentralised technologies
Blockchain technology is reshaping startup landscapes by enabling secure and transparent transactions. Startups are leveraging blockchain and decentralized technologies to create decentralized applications that enhance security and trust. This approach reduces the need for intermediaries in business dealings.
Smart contracts, enabled by blockchain, automate agreements and improve efficiency in sectors like finance, supply chain, and logistics. Startups are also exploring decentralized autonomous organizations (DAOs), which empower communities by shifting control from centralized entities to stakeholders.

Energy Storage and sreen hydrogen
Energy storage systems are crucial for stabilizing the energy grid, especially with the increasing use of renewables. Technologies like lithium-ion batteries are commonly used, but innovations in energy storage are on the rise. Green hydrogen offers a promising solution for long-term, sustainable energy storage.
Sustainable practices are key to developing green hydrogen, produced using renewable energy sources. Its potential lies in storing excess solar and wind energy, which can then be converted back to electricity when needed.
Integrating energy storage systems with grid infrastructure enhances reliability and efficiency. This transition is crucial for supporting renewable energy adoption and reducing carbon footprints. In the future, you may see green hydrogen and advanced storage solutions becoming integral to energy systems worldwide.
Cloud computing and edge computing
Cloud computing continues to revolutionize IT infrastructure by providing scalable and flexible resources. Its integration into business operations allows for efficient data management and processing. However, as data volume grows, edge computing becomes increasingly important.
Edge computing brings computational power closer to data sources, reducing latency and bandwidth usage. This is especially relevant in IoT applications and time-sensitive processes. Industry trends indicate a growing demand for hybrid models combining cloud and edge solutions.
Opting for these technologies can enhance speed and reliability. By distributing resources intelligently, you can improve performance while minimizing costs. As technology matures, expect to see wider adoption across various sectors, enabling sophisticated applications and services.
